The main objective of an effective Weston Termite Treatment is to get rid of any existing termite colonies and develop a strong protective barrier around the structure. The use of chemical soil treatments is a popular and reliable method for accomplishing this. This procedure includes the application of a liquid termiticide to Weston Termite Treatment the soil beneath and surrounding the home's foundations. Advanced non-repellent chemicals are particularly effective as termites are unable to discover them. As the termites move through the cured area, they unwittingly come into contact with the compound and transfer it to the rest of the nest through their grooming habits. This leads to the total elimination of the nest instead of just a short-term deterrence.
An advanced approach to termite control in Weston is making use of baiting and tracking systems, which is particularly appropriate for homes with comprehensive paving or intricate landscaping that makes standard soil treatment tough. Strategically positioned monitoring stations are set up around the perimeter of the home, each containing wooden bait that tempts foraging termites. Upon discovering termite activity, a powerful bait is added to the station, which is then carried back to the nest by worker termites, eventually preventing the colony's development by interrupting the termites' ability to shed their skin. This method provides an extensive option that targets the root of the problem, even if the primary nest is located below the surface area or on surrounding land.
Taking actions to prevent wood-boring pests is just as vital as treating them after they appear. Homeowners can make their property less appealing to these pests by ensuring correct ventilation in subfloor areas to keep the wood dry, as termites are drawn in to damp conditions. It's also a good concept to refrain from storing firewood or garden mulch near your house's outer walls, as this can offer bugs a method to bypass any defenses. Frequently examining for leakages and repairing defective seamless gutters can also assist prevent wetness accumulation in the soil, which termites could use to go into the property.
